"Call in for a pot of tea and excellent sandwiches. I had cream cheese and cucumber and my friend had the house twist on BLT. I was asked if my dog would like a treat and he was brought a sausage cut up, presented in a little dish. Large pot of tea to share which is quite unusual.The staff were friendly and welcoming and the food simple and good. This is the perfect place to sit and watch the world go by."

This is the second time we've stopped here for coffee whilst driving through Wensleydale. The coffee and cakes are delicious and the owners friendly and welcoming. We had a conducted tour of the B B accommodation and were pleasantly surprised by the spacious rooms and excellent facilities. This will certainly be top of the list for an overnight stay when we're planning a longer visit to the area.
